金融行业数学建模是一种将数学理论和方法应用于金融市场分析和预测的方法。通过构建大模型,可以更准确地预测市场趋势,为投资者提供有价值的信息。以下是构建大模型以预测市场趋势的步骤和内容:
1. 确定目标和问题:首先,明确建模的目标和问题,例如预测股票市场的趋势、外汇市场的波动等。这将有助于确定需要收集的数据类型和指标。
2. 数据收集和处理:收集与目标相关的历史数据,包括价格、交易量、宏观经济指标等。对数据进行清洗、归一化等预处理操作,以便更好地进行分析。
3. 特征工程:从原始数据中提取有用的特征,如移动平均线、相对强弱指数(RSI)、布林带等技术指标。这些特征可以帮助解释市场行为,并提高模型的预测能力。
4. 选择模型:根据问题的性质选择合适的数学模型。常见的模型有线性回归、时间序列分析、机器学习算法等。对于金融市场预测,可以考虑使用ARIMA模型、随机森林、神经网络等。
5. 参数调优:通过交叉验证等方法调整模型的参数,以提高预测的准确性。这可能需要多次尝试和优化,以达到最佳性能。
6. 集成学习:考虑将多个模型的结果进行融合,以提高预测的稳定性和准确性。常用的集成学习方法有Bagging、Boosting和Stacking等。
7. 模型评估:使用适当的评价指标(如均方误差、R平方值等)对模型进行评估,以确保其性能达到预期。同时,可以使用实际数据进行回测,以验证模型的实用性。
8. 风险管理:在模型开发过程中,需要考虑各种风险因素,如市场风险、信用风险等。可以通过设置止损点、分散投资等方式来降低风险。
9. 持续监控和更新:金融市场是不断变化的,因此需要定期更新模型,以适应新的市场环境。此外,还需要关注外部事件对市场的影响,如政策变动、自然灾害等。
通过以上步骤,可以构建一个有效的大模型来预测金融市场趋势。然而,需要注意的是,任何模型都存在一定的局限性和不确定性,因此在实际应用中需要谨慎对待。